Composed by the talented duo Nigel Clarke and Michael Csányi-Wills, "The Rocket Post (Original Motion Picture Soundtrack)" is a captivating musical journey that accompanies the 2004 film of the same name. Released on July 3, 2007, by MovieScore Media, this soundtrack is a testament to the composers' ability to evoke a range of emotions and atmospheres through their music.
Recorded by the prestigious Royal Philharmonic Orchestra in London, the album spans 48 minutes and features 19 tracks that beautifully complement the film's narrative. From the serene "Distant Shores" to the dramatic "Betrayal" and the triumphant "First Flight," each piece is a masterful blend of orchestral arrangements and subtle vocal performances by Mae McKenna.
Nigel Clarke, known for his work on films like "Jinnah" and "The Little Vampire," brings his signature style to this soundtrack, creating a rich and immersive musical landscape. Michael Csányi-Wills, a collaborator on several projects, contributes his unique perspective, resulting in a harmonious fusion of their individual talents.
